U.S. NATIONALS CHAMPION ANGELLE SAVOIE TO APPEAR ON FRIDAY'S RPM2NIGHT
Americus, Ga., September 5, 2002 - Two-time defending NHRA Pro Stock
Motorcycle champion Angelle Savoie, who last weekend scored her second
consecutive U.S. Nationals win, will be a featured guest on this Friday's
edition of RPM2Night. The show is scheduled to air on September 6 at 6:30
p.m. (Eastern) on ESPN2.
RPM2Night is ESPN's daily half-hour motorsports news and highlights show
hosted by John Kernan from the ESPN studios in Charlotte, N.C. The RPM2Night
crew has also recently returned from Indianapolis, having broadcast last
week's shows from Indianapolis Raceway Park, site of the Mac Tools U.S.
Nationals.
Angelle, who was named Pro Stock Motorcycle Rider of the year at last week's
Car Craft Drag Racing All-Stars awards banquet, currently leads the NHRA
POWERade championship points standings by 111 points over second place Craig
Treble. In addition to speaking about her exciting win in Indianapolis,
Angelle is also expected to discuss the Star Racing team's recent
announcement welcoming famed Connecticut gaming and entertainment resort
Mohegan Sun as their primary sponsor for the remainder of the 2002 NHRA
season.
